In 2004, Victoria Rocha gave birth to her oldest son in state prison, causing her great distress when her dad and stepmom picked up her baby boy and drove off, leaving her feeling empty and upset. After her release, a few years later, she lost her battle with drug addiction, landing her back in prison and away from her growing family: four boys and one girl in total. But after three years, a judge released her and granted her permission to transfer directly to a rehabilitation center named Evangel Home. There, for the first time, she worked on herself and her relationship with her children. She was determined to prove herself to her family, to her children, and to herself.

Now she is focused on starting a new life with her children and is currently a full-time student at California State University, Fresno. She also works with formerly incarcerated students at Fresno City College as a student peer mentor.
